Our Fellowship: The Church

The church is the collective body of Christian believers. There are five fundamental facts about the church.

1

Biblical Basis

The church is founded upon and bound by the scriptures as its sole ultimate authority.

"And are built upon the foundation of the apostles and prophets, Jesus Christ himself being the chief corner stone." - Ephesians 2:20
2

Regenerated Community

The church is exclusively composed of true believers in Christ, who have subsequently professed their faith in baptism.

"...the Lord added to the church daily such as should be saved." - Acts 2:47
3

Separated Conduct

The church is called by God to holiness, to live in a righteous manner, both individually and corporately.

"Wherefore come out from among them, and be ye separate, saith the Lord, and touch not the unclean thing; and I will receive you, And will be a Father unto you, and ye shall be my sons and daughters, saith the Lord Almighty." - 2 Corinthians 6:17-18
4

Local Gathering

The church is a local congregation of believers who regularly meet together in a definite, physical location.

"Not forsaking the assembling of ourselves together, as the manner of some is; but exhorting one another: and so much the more, as ye see the day approaching." - Hebrews 10:25
5

Autonomous Government

The church is run by a locally-appointed board of elders, independent of external governance.

"Take heed therefore unto yourselves, and to all the flock, over the which the Holy Ghost hath made you overseers, to feed the church of God, which he hath purchased with his own blood." - Acts 20:28
